Publication number: 20080249277Abstract: A polyurethane elastomer useful as a cleaning blade of an electronic copying machine having a small temperature dependency over a wide range of atmospheric temperatures is produced by reacting (1) a polyol component, (2) a chain extender, and (3) an isocyanate component. The polyol component includes a bifunctional silicone oil having hydroxyl groups at both ends and containing an ester group. The isocyanate component includes an aromatic isocyanate. The silicone oil content of the elastomer is from 5.0 to 50% by weight, based on the weight of the polyurethane elastomer. In a preferred embodiment, the polyurethane elastomer is produced from a polyol component which includes a polycaprolactone ester polyol and a silicone oil having hydroxyl groups at both ends which also contains an ester group.Type: ApplicationFiled: February 25, 2008Publication date: October 9, 2008Inventors: Takeshi Sanjo, Takehiro Shimizu, Kohichi Katamura

Patent number: 7222244Abstract: A semiconductor device having a functional circuit block with predictive power controller is provided so as to construct a system LSI manufactured in a practicable number of design steps, which is extensible and in which power is reduced. The functional circuit block includes a prediction circuit and a predictive power shutdown circuit having a power status control circuit. The prediction circuit controls a power status of the functional circuit block by using the power status control circuit, based on input information thereto. When no information is inputted for a predetermined a period of time, the power status control circuit shifts from a power status of the functional circuit block to a low-power status.Type: GrantFiled: August 20, 2001Date of Patent: May 22, 2007Assignee: Hitachi, Ltd.Inventors: Takayuki Kawahara, Takehiro Shimizu, Fumio Arakawa, Hiroyuki Mizuno, Takao Watanabe, Koichiro Ishibashi

Publication number: 20070003679Abstract: A sweetener containing a Stevia-derived sweet substance is provided that, while containing cyclodextrin only in small amounts, can mask the bitter taste inherent in the Stevia-derived sweet substance. Cyclodextrin with a particle size of less than or equal to 30 ?m is blended into the Stevia-derived sweet substance at 0.5 to 20 mass % with respect to the mass of the Stevia-derived sweet substance.Type: ApplicationFiled: March 1, 2006Publication date: January 4, 2007Applicant: Sato Pharmaceutical Co., Ltd.Inventors: Takehiro Shimizu, Mitsutoshi Tatara, Toshihito Shimizu
